Brief Summary: Evaluation of safety and efficacy of PL9643 Ophthalmic Solution compared to placebo for the treatment of the signs and symptoms of dry eye.
Detailed Description: The clinical trial is a Phase 2, multi center, randomized, double masked and placebo controlled study.

During a 14-day study run-in period (for the purpose of subject selection) prior to randomization, all subjects will receive Placebo Ophthalmic Solution (vehicle) bilaterally. During the screening period, exposure to the CAEĀ® will be conducted to ascertain eligibility to enter the study at Visit 1 and Visit 2. Those who qualify at Visit 2 will be randomized to receive study drug in a double-masked fashion for 12 weeks. The CAEĀ® exposure will occur at all Visits.
